Donja R. Love’s
SUGAR IN OUR WOUNDS
Directed by Sarah Bellamy
Set on a Southern plantation in 1862, this piercing drama explores queer Black love against a backdrop of imminent freedom. Two young enslaved men torn from their families find solace in one another, propelling them into a harrowing fight for love and survival.
